Police stops live coverage of Saraki's trial

Date: 2015-09-22

The Police have stopped the live coverage of the ongoing trial of the Senate President, Bukola Saraki, who is facing a 13-count criminal charge bordering on false declaration of assets preferred against him.

The Senate President, Bukola Saraki, has arrived the Tribunal by 9:30 to face charges against him by the Code of Conduct Bureau. The trial judge is expected as at the time of filing this report.

SECURITY was unusually tight at the Code of Conduct Tribunal, this morning, as the Senate President and former governor of Kwara state, Bukola Saraki, is expected to appear before the Danladi Umar-led Tribunal.

The Court of Appeal and the Federal High Court, both sitting in Abuja, yesterday, refused to shield the Senate President, Dr Bukola Saraki from being arraigned at the Code of Conduct Tribunal, CCT, on a 13-count criminal charge bordering on false declaration of assets preferred against him. The Senate President had approached both courts to provide him shelter and save him from being docked.
